Range and Efficiency

The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) P8 AWD (2020-2021) boasts a greater real-world range, a larger battery, and superior energy efficiency compared to the Audi e-tron 50 quattro (2019-2022).

Property Audi e-tron 50 quattro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) P8 AWD
Range (EPA) - Range (EPA) 208 mi
Range (WLTP) 212 mi 260 mi
Range (GCC) 169 mi 214 mi
Battery Capacity (Nominal) 71 kWh 78 kWh
Battery Capacity (Usable) 64.7 kWh 75 kWh
Efficiency per 100 mi 38.3 kWh/100 mi 35 kWh/100 mi
Efficiency per kWh 2.61 mi/kWh 2.85 mi/kWh
Range and Efficiency Score 3.5 5

Charging

Both vehicles utilize a standard 400-volt architecture.

The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) P8 AWD (2020-2021) offers faster charging speeds at DC stations, reaching up to 150 kW, while the Audi e-tron 50 quattro (2019-2022) maxes out at 120 kW.

Both vehicles are equipped with the same on-board charger, supporting a maximum AC charging power of 11 kW.

Property Audi e-tron 50 quattro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) P8 AWD
Max Charging Power (AC) 11 kW 11 kW
Max Charging Power (DC) 120 kW 150 kW
Architecture 400 V 400 V
Charge Port CCS Type 2 CCS Type 1
Charging Score 5.9 6.4

Performance

Both vehicles are all-wheel drive.

The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) P8 AWD (2020-2021) boasts greater motor power and accelerates faster from 0 to 60 mph.

Property Audi e-tron 50 quattro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) P8 AWD
Drive Type AWD AWD
Motor Type IM (front), IM (rear) PMSM (front), PMSM (rear)
Motor Power (kW) 230 kW 300 kW
Motor Power (hp) 308 hp 402 hp
Motor Torque 398 lb-ft 487 lb-ft
0-60 mph 6.5 s 4.7 s
Top Speed 118 mph 112 mph
Performance Score 4.8 5.5

Cargo and Towing

The Audi e-tron 50 quattro (2019-2022) provides more cargo capacity, featuring both a larger trunk and more space with the rear seats folded.

Both models feature a convenient frunk (front trunk), providing additional storage space.

The Audi e-tron 50 quattro (2019-2022) is better suited for heavy loads, offering a greater towing capacity than the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) P8 AWD (2020-2021).

Property Audi e-tron 50 quattro Volvo XC40 Recharge (EX40) P8 AWD
Number of Seats 5 5
Curb Weight 5400 lb 4824 lb
Cargo Volume (Trunk) 23.3 ft3 16 ft3
Cargo Volume (Max) 60.9 ft3 57.5 ft3
Cargo Volume (Frunk) 1.8 ft3 0.7 ft3
Towing Capacity 4000 lb 2000 lb
Cargo and Towing Score 7.7 6.7
